Core Parameters

The lighting is set to natural overcast daylight, which provides soft, diffused illumination. This is essential for snowy scenes, as it minimizes harsh shadows and highlights, making the subject appear more flattering. If you were to switch to direct sunlight, you'd risk creating stark contrasts and unflattering shadows. For a more dramatic effect, consider using golden hour light, which adds warmth and depth.

Color and Texture

The color palette focuses on neutral winter tones, which harmonize beautifully with the snowy background. If you wanted a more vibrant image, you could introduce a pop of color through accessories. The texture quality emphasizes the materials of the clothing, making the faux fur and leggings look realistic. Avoid overly smooth textures that can make the image appear artificial.

Practical Tips

    1. Experiment with the depth of field. A moderate f-stop (like f/4.0) keeps the subject sharp while softly blurring the background, enhancing focus on the model.
    2. For a more dynamic composition, try varying the framing. Instead of a full-body shot, consider a tighter crop focusing on the upper body.
    3. Avoid common mistakes like oversaturation in colors and harsh lighting. Stick to natural tones and soft lighting for a more photorealistic effect.
